.NET vs. Java
It's not surprising that both IBM and Microsoft are jockeying for the leadership position in the new paradigm of Web programming languages. Microsoft is pushing its .NET initiative centered around C#, its new programming language. By contrast, IBM is backing Java for everything from mainframes to desktops.

But in the end (if there is such a thing) which company's approach will win out? Microsoft's .NET initiative or IBM's Java-based strategy? Or will it be something else? There's wide acceptance of Java, but Microsoft is putting a lot of money and marketing muscle behind .NET.

What about all those Visual Basic programmers or those who use C++ or even COBOL? Is there room for numerous languages?

Tip of the Week:
Finding the missing piece of the V5R1 installation manual
If you've installed or upgraded OS/400 software before, you know it's IBM's practice to send a printed copy of its Software Installation manual along with the step-by-step instructions for installation media and other documentation. A key chapter is Chapter 3, Preparing for Software Installation. There's only one problem with that chapter in the V5R1 Software Installation manual: IBM left it out of the paper manual and moved it to the V5R1 eServer iSeries 400 Information Center Web site. Gone is the relatively easy task of documenting your installation and making sure you did it correctly.
